112th Infantry

The 112th Infantry, also known as the 112th Indian Infantry Regiment, was a distinguished regiment of the British Indian Army formed in 1857. Initially raised during the Indian Rebellion, the regiment played a critical role in various conflicts throughout the 19th and early 20th centuries. It gained notoriety for its exemplary service in World War I, distinguishing itself in multiple campaigns across the Middle East and Europe. In 1922, the 112th Infantry was reorganized and ultimately became part of the Indian Army following India's independence in 1947. The regiment's legacy continues to be honored by various military traditions and commemorations in India. Its contributions to the military history of India remain significant in the context of colonial and post-colonial eras.
